Trivia about the song For Always by Lalah Hathaway

On which albums was the song “For Always” released by Lalah Hathaway?
Lalah Hathaway released the song on the albums “Outrun The Sky” in 2004 and “Self Portrait” in 2008.
Who composed the song “For Always” by Lalah Hathaway?
The song “For Always” by Lalah Hathaway was composed by Lalah Hathaway and Rex Rideout.
